Preparing your request details

Before submitting a removal request, compile key information such as account identifiers, links to the content in question, and any evidence of ownership. Draft a concise description of the data you want removed, including why it should be deleted and any applicable legal or policy bases. Consider outlining preferred timelines for response and steps you are willing to take if immediate action isn’t possible. This preparation helps ensure the request is precise and actionable for the data controller.

Filing with the right channels

Use the official form or contact point provided by the service to submit your request. Many platforms offer dedicated privacy portals or support inboxes for data removal or deletion requests. Attach relevant documents and reference the exact data items you want addressed. If you encounter obstacles, escalate through customer support or privacy complaint mechanisms available in your region. Responsiveness often hinges on using the proper channel and providing complete context.

Tracking the request and handling responses

After submission, monitor the status of your request regularly. Keep an organized log of confirmations, decisions, and any required follow ups. If the platform asks for additional information, respond promptly with the precise data they request. Some agencies or companies provide case numbers; storing these helps you manage ongoing communications and reduces the chance of misfiled requests or lost documents.

Practical tips for faster outcomes

To increase the likelihood of a timely resolution, tailor your request to the platform’s stated privacy policy and data handling practices. Be specific about the scope of data you want removed and avoid broad generalizations. When appropriate, cite applicable laws or terms of service that support your request. Maintaining a respectful, persistent approach often yields better results than informal messages. Privacy considerations should remain the guiding factor throughout the process.
